==Summary==
The ridged band area is situated just inside the tip of the foreskin. The ridged band area contains Meissner corpusples arrange in rete ridges. The Meissner corpuscles are stimulated by motion and stretching. The foreskin contains a layer of muscle tissue called the dartos fascia.<ref name="cold-taylor" /> [[Dartos| The dartos fascia ]] allows a considerable degree of motion and stretching to stimulate the Meissner corpuscles, which provides significant stimulation during sexual activity.
